Jack The Ripper (1959)| Episode 441

Jim Adams
About this episode

Jim discusses his first experience with a classic 1959 Horror-Thriller based on an infamous London serial killer - "Jack The Ripper, starring Lee Patterson, Eddie Byrne, Betty McDowall, Ewen Solon, John Le Mesurier, Jack Allen, Endre Muller, and Directed by Monty Berman and Robert S Baker. An American police detective assists Scotland Yard in stopping a killer that is haunting London in the late 1800s.
